The Basic Principles Of E2 Visa Table of ContentsThe smart Trick of E2 Visa That Nobody is Talking AboutE2 Visa Fundamentals ExplainedE2 Visa Can Be Fun For EveryoneThe 5-Second Trick For E2 VisaAbout E2 VisaNevertheless, spending $100,000 is not a mandatory and does not assure visa approval. Our E2 visa https://civillawyer63949.pages10.com/e2-visa-for-investors-71696572